Highpower International, Inc. (NASDAQ: HPJ) is engaged in the development and marketing of advanced rechargeable battery technologies, primarily focusing on nickel metal hydride (Ni-MH) and lithium-ion (Li-ion) batteries. With a product portfolio that includes energy storage solutions for electric vehicles (EVs), consumer electronics, and other applications, HPJ operates in the growing energy transition sector. The company aims to capture demand from the increasing focus on renewable energy and sustainable battery technologies.
